Description: Tolfenamic Acid (formerly GEA 6414; GEA6414; GEA-6414; Clotam), a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s), is a potent and selective COX-2 inhibitor with potential anti-inflammatory activity. It inhibits COX-2 with an IC50 of 0.2 uM.
References: Int Immunopharmacol. 2016 Jun; 35:287-93; J Neurochem. 2015 Apr; 133(2):266-72.
Chemical Name: 2-((3-chloro-2-methylphenyl)amino)benzoic acid
InChi Key: YEZNLOUZAIOMLT-UHFFFAOYSA-N
InChi Code: InChI=1S/C14H12ClNO2/c1-9-11(15)6-4-8-12(9)16-13-7-3-2-5-10(13)14(17)18/h2-8, 16H, 1H3, (H, 17, 18)
SMILES: O=C(O)C1=CC=CC=C1NC2=CC=CC(Cl)=C2C
